What's your Unique Selling Point?
In other words, why would people come to you versus your competition?

Make a business plan: (rough example below. I'm sure there are more factors)

Monthly expenses:
Rent
IT
Electricity
Employees
Filters
Maintenance
Ink
Paper
Cleaner

Occasional expenses:
New equipment
Advertisements

One time expenses:
Construction
Branding
Computers
Keyboards
Printers
Mouse
Desks
Chairs

Profit:
Calculate expenses- (you can divide the one time and occasional by 12)
How much will users pay per hour?
About how many hours will users use your kiosk?
How many hours can you expect per month?
How many hours do you need per month to cut even?
How much more do you need to earn your desired profit?

Make an educated decision if this is profitable for you.

Not closing doesn't mean it's money making. Sometimes people hope for the best. They try to make back their investment, etc. Other times, their books are mismanaged and they don't realize they're losing money...

I can try to help you with rough estimates.
Are you renting a place?
It depends a lot on the size of your place.
Location in BP?
Are you hiring people?
About how many computers?


Here's rough estimates based on a medium size place, in BP- not central. 10 computers. 1 blue collar employee.

Monthly expenses:
Rent: $2,500
High speed internet: $300
IT: $700
Electricity: $500
Employee (can also be your cleaner): $4,000
Security: $50
Filters: $250
Maintenance: $200
Ink: $150
Paper: $150
Extras: $200

Total monthly: $9,000
If you don't hire anyone and you do the work: $5,000


Occasional expenses:
New equipment: 2 New computers per year: $2,000
Advertisements: 4 advertisements in local papers: $2,000

One time expenses: (on a budget)
Construction- basics: $2,000
Branding- basics: $2,500
Computers- 10: $10,000
Keyboards: $1000
Printers: $400
Mouse: $200
Cameras- security: $1000
Desks: $5,000
Cubicles: $5,000
Chairs: $2,000
Extras: $1,000

Total: $30,000

Expense Totals: $30,000 investment
Occasional: $5,000 annually
Monthly: $5,000 (if you don't hire)

Profit:
How much will users pay per hour? $8
About how many hours will users use your kiosk? 5 hours/ month
How many customers can you expect per month? (depends on many factors)
How many customers do you need to make back your investment? 750
How many customers do you need per month to cut even? 125
How much more do you need to earn your desired profit?

Do you think it's possible for you to have minimum 125 separate customers per month plus an additional 750 customers per year (to make back your investment)? If yes, you'll cut even. More than that, you'll make profit.
